Transaction 4903e61538b3577c653dd6a67c67635a816b27fdc553a3c922561e9caef83542
3 Input
2 Outputs
- 4903e61538b3577c653dd6a67c67635a816b27fdc553a3c922561e9caef83542:0
- 4903e61538b3577c653dd6a67c67635a816b27fdc553a3c922561e9caef83542:1
value 2845868
address 16SNTkJgNckDaJ3rqSdj9fkwHXSGQjEJm3
value 30000000
address 3FF1uZ5oEaSZYKCvGbywu39djsknrGeu96